Living in Lancaster, CA

Transportation options in Lancaster include a public bus system with routes connecting key areas of the city. While the bus schedules vary, they generally provide consistent service during peak hours. The city is also served by a network of major roads and highways, including State Route 14, facilitating travel to nearby cities and regions. Lancaster is increasingly accommodating to ride-sharing services, enhancing mobility for residents without personal vehicles. The city's layout offers varying degrees of walkability, with certain neighborhoods being more pedestrian-friendly than others.

Residents of Lancaster have access to a range of services, including a network of public schools, with multiple elementary, middle, and high schools serving the community. Healthcare is supported by local hospitals and clinics offering a variety of services from emergency care to specialized treatments. The city also features a selection of retail and dining options that cater to a range of tastes, with local businesses and national chains present.

Lancaster prides itself on its community spirit and the annual California Poppy Festival, which showcases the region's natural beauty and cultural heritage. The city's character is further defined by its commitment to arts and innovation, with public art installations and a thriving aerospace industry contributing to its unique identity.

The housing landscape in Lancaster is characterized by a mix of single-family homes, apartments, and townhouses, with single-family homes being the most prevalent. Architectural styles vary, with modern, ranch, and desert-inspired designs reflecting the local aesthetic. The market is composed of a blend of older homes dating back to the mid-20th century and newer constructions that have expanded the city's residential areas.
